Noerdingen (also Nördingen , Luxembourgish Näerden , French Noerdange ) is a Luxembourgish village with 498 inhabitants in the municipality of Beckerich in the canton of Redingen .

The village is traversed by the Näerdenerbaach stream.

The village had a train station on the Pétingen – Ettelbrück railway ( Attert line ), where the narrow-gauge railway to Martelingen branched off. Both routes are closed today.
